首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何根据链接在页面上显示来自ACF的WP自定义字段

根据链接在页面上显示来自ACF的WP自定义字段,可以通过以下步骤实现:

  1. 首先,确保你已经安装并激活了Advanced Custom Fields(ACF)插件,该插件可以让你轻松创建和管理自定义字段。
  2. 在WordPress后台,进入“自定义字段”选项,创建一个新的自定义字段组。在该组中,你可以定义需要显示的字段类型,例如文本、图像、日期等。
  3. 在自定义字段组中,为每个字段设置一个唯一的名称和标签,以便在后续的代码中引用。
  4. 在需要显示自定义字段的页面模板中,使用ACF提供的函数来获取和显示字段的值。例如,可以使用get_field('field_name')函数来获取特定字段的值。
  5. 将获取到的字段值插入到页面的适当位置。你可以使用HTML和CSS来自定义字段的显示方式,使其符合你的需求和设计。
  6. 如果你需要在链接中显示自定义字段的值,可以将字段值作为参数添加到链接的URL中。例如,可以使用get_field('field_name')函数获取字段值,并将其添加到链接的href属性中。

以下是一个示例代码,展示如何根据链接在页面上显示来自ACF的WP自定义字段:

代码语言:txt
复制
<?php
// 获取自定义字段的值
$field_value = get_field('field_name');

// 构建链接URL,并将字段值作为参数添加到URL中
$link_url = 'https://example.com/?custom_field=' . $field_value;
?>

<a href="<?php echo esc_url($link_url); ?>">点击这里查看自定义字段的值</a>

在上述示例中,field_name是你在ACF中定义的自定义字段的名称。你可以根据实际情况修改代码,并根据需要自定义链接的显示方式。

请注意,以上答案中没有提及腾讯云相关产品和产品介绍链接地址,因为这些信息需要根据具体的需求和场景来确定。你可以根据自己的需求,参考腾讯云的文档和产品介绍页面,选择适合的云计算产品来支持你的WordPress网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WP Engine推出AI驱动WordPress网站搜索

AI 及其将如何改变网站是此次 De{Code} 一个重要讨论点,主题演讲专门针对该主题。...利用高级自定义字段进行智能搜索 ACF 代表 高级自定义字段,适用于 CMS。...有 解决方案 和插件,允许网站创建者定义和添加超出 WordPress 提供基本字段自定义字段,但 Patterson 谈论是默认 WordPress 搜索,他承认它不能很好地处理这些搜索期望,...“我们所做是索引和映射你 ACF 字段,开箱即用,点击一个按钮,无需自定义映射,无需简码,无需任何代码,你只需在智能搜索中默认索引所有 ACF 和所有自定义帖子类型,”他说。...将搜索从 WordPress 数据库中卸载,并自动索引 ACF 字段所有自定义帖子类型——我们认为这是我们在此处 […] 独一无二地方;再次希望以 WordPress 开发人员工作方式工作,”他说

9510

WordPress建站技术笔记

解决办法 自定义主题里通常会自带jquery文件,首先关掉Autoptimize,然后用浏览器找出jquery路径。...Warning: Illegal string offset php xxx in 这个问题直接出现在页面上,影响用户体验。原因是现有的php版本比较新,比如我用了7.2版本,不再支持先前语法。...修改代码,使用isset函数,先判断是不是存在这个字段。 关闭warning告警。...让超链接在新标签打开 wordpress默认是当前打开,但在文章中,有时候会有些引用链接,此时我们希望可以在新标签中打开。 解决办法 在Theme Editor中修改主题代码。加入以下代码。...所以放在headerhead标签里,所有的超链接都会在新标签打开。 如果放在部分页面中,就可以只让某些页面的超链接在新标签打开。比如文章single.php。

78920

WordPress防采集办法和解决思路

) { $paged = 10;//超过 10 后就显示 404 if($paged && $wp_query->get('paged') > $paged){ //404 页面...翻页超过 10 后就会调用 WordPress 主题 404 页面,可以通过修改代码 paged 参数值修改翻页数量来自定义。...代码中会对所有的列表页面都生效,首页、文章归档(分类、标签、日期)、搜索页面等都一视同仁,还可以根据自己需要添加判断,根据不同列表做不同限制,子凡这里就不展开分享了。...另外如果你翻译使用是 get_next_posts_link(string $label=null, int $max_page) 来翻页下一,还可以通过设置最大翻页来避免出现翻页死情况出现。...由于我们 WordPress 交流群有人在问具体栏目自定义屏蔽页数怎么办,所以就再来稍微修整一下,一下代码中数字“10”就是可以自定义根据后面的备注修改就可以了。

79140

在Genesis主题中手动添加WordPress相关文章

我们在这里实现效果是以网格形式显示三篇相关文章,包括文章特色图像、标题和最多20个单词摘录,并且允许你自己选择要显示文章。通过这种方式,你可以更好地控制与某篇文章相关内容。...所以,让我们开始吧 第一步:使用ACF创建自定义字段 首先,我们需要创建所需自定义字段,以帮助我们获取所需数据,即关系字段类型。请按照下图进行正确设置。...还有一个更简单方法,你可以在这里下载我导出ACF配置文件,并将文件导入ACF。 related-posts.zipDownload ?...''; echo wp_trim_words( get_the_content( $relatedPost->ID ), 20, null ); echo...可以从下面的图中看到,你可以完全控制要显示内容。我们已限制3个帖子,因此你将无法添加超过3个帖子。选择时候,你可以使用目录进行过滤。 ? 这样就可以了。

1.3K30

WordPress自定义字段插件:Advanced Custom Fields超详细使用教程

可以用这个插件创建一个网站设置页面字段,可以用来自由编辑网站标题、LOGO、banner,版权文字等等只要你想得到都可以。比如我就曾经建立一个页面截图: ? ?...二、设置字段显示位置 位置选项如下所示,具体您自己去测试就行了,就不多介绍了。 ?...>"> 自定义文章类型如何使用字段 1、自定义文章类型分类获取分类自定义字段方法: /**只需要将_fmt修改成你字段名即可**/ 2、自定义文章类型文章获取该自定义分类字段 /**只需要将_fmt修改成你字段名即可(product_category是你自定义分类法名字,根据情况替换修改)**/

4.8K30

一个函数就搞定 WordPress 文章选项开发

wpjam_register_post_option('seo', [ 'title' => 'SEO设置', // 文章选项标题 'context' => 'side', // 显示在文章编辑侧边...list_table:定义后台文章列表是否也支持弹窗设置文章选项 fields:那么这个文章选项框有哪些字段呢?就是这个参数决定,这里定义了两个输入框和一个文本框。...设置」按钮也可以进行同样设置: 在页面上使用文章选项 创建了选项之后,那么我们就要把他们用起来,WordPress 提供了获取自定义字段函数: get_post_meta($post_id, $met_key..., $single); // 获取文章自定义字段 首先把在文章详情将页面标题改成上面定义「SEO标题」: add_filter('document_title', function($title){...: $title; } return $title; }); 然后把「SEO描述」和「SEO关键字」输出到文章详情 head 中: add_action('wp_head', function

35830

非常适合个人搭建博客—WordPress开源免费主题汇总

如何选择?...支持自定义配色,允许设置主色调,侧边栏显示方式,显示幻灯片等配置。 SEO友好 主题自带SEO配置,智能设置每篇文章SEO功能,并提供文章独立SEO配置。...、文章过时信息显示 Pjax – 支持 Pjax 无刷新加载,提高浏览体验 友情链接 – 支持使用 WordPress 自带链接管理器进行友管理,支持多种友样式 “说说” 功能 – 随时发表想法,...主题特性: pjax无刷新体验 12种配色,5种布局,支持暗黑模式 侧边栏小工具,音乐播放器,内置Mac界面代码高亮行号显示, 强大后台设置 丰富自定义页面 [mf-wp-zhuti_15.gif]...无刷新评论、翻页 来自ViewImage驱动极简灯箱(1kb) Lately驱动时间格式化插件(800字节) [mf-wp-zhuti_18.gif] 十七、MDx主题 网站: 作者:https:/

15.8K34

WordPress自定义查询WP_Query使用方法大全

, //(布尔值) - 在一显示所有文章或使用分页,默认值为 'false', 使用分页 'paged' => get_query_var('paged'), //(整数) - 页数,分页时显示第几页...'second' => 30, //(int) - 秒 (从 0 到 60). /** * 自定义字段参数 - 显示拥有某个自定义字段文章 */ 'meta_key' => 'key', //(字符串...) - 自定义字段键 'meta_value' => 'value', //(字符串) - 自定义字段值 'meta_value_num' => 10, //(数字) - 自定义字段值 'meta_compare...'meta_query' => array( //(数组) - 自定义字段参数 (3.1和以后版本可用). array( 'key' => 'color', //(字符串) - 自定义字段键...$query = new WP_Query( 'p=36' );   调用指定page页面或category分类可以用类似的写法 $query = new WP_Query( 'cat=9' );//

4K41

WordPress自定义查询:WP_Query使用

wordpress默认会根据网址调用数据,不能满足我们所有建站要求,而WP_Query可以用于查询任何你想要内容,相当于自定义数据调用。 wordpress主循环 30, //(int) - 秒 (从 0 到 60). /** * 自定义字段参数 - 显示拥有某个自定义字段文章 */ 'meta_key' => 'key', //(字符串...) - 自定义字段键 'meta_value' => 'value', //(字符串) - 自定义字段值 'meta_value_num' => 10, //(数字) - 自定义字段值 'meta_compare...'meta_query' => array( //(数组) - 自定义字段参数 (3.1和以后版本可用). array( 'key' => 'color', //(字符串) - 自定义字段键...= new WP_Query( 'p=10' ); 调用指定page页面或category分类可以用类似的写法 $query = new WP_Query( 'cat=8' );//调用指定分类文章

1.4K20

每天一个WordPress文件:wp-config.php

不管如何,下面的设置就是分别需要输入你数据库名字,连接 MySQL 数据库用户名,密码和数据库主机。...表 如果多个系统需要对接 WordPress 需要用到其他系统用户表,那么可以通过下面两个字段来自定义: define( 'CUSTOM_USER_TABLE', $table_prefix.'...themes 目录不可以迁移,因为 themes 目录是根据 wp-content 目录写死: $theme_root = WP_CONTENT_DIR ....', 3 ); Debug WordPress Version 2.3.1 增加了这个选项,并且通过 WP_DEBUG_DISPLAY 和 WP_DEBUG_LOG 用于控制 PHP 错误和警告显示和写入...中 define( 'WP_DEBUG_DISPLAY', true ); // 直接在面上显示错误 log 如果想去 debug 默认 JS 和 CSS 文件,可以在 wp-config.php

66030

WordPress 5.9 增强了懒加载性能

如何实现 WordPress 如何实现这一改进呢?...WordPress 希望开箱即用,所以新增一个新函数,并在函数内设置了一个计数器,以便可以跳过给页面上第一个“内容图像或 iframe”设置懒加载。...文章详情和列表都适用,在文章详情,当前文章第一个图片和 iframe 不是懒加载,而在文章列表,则所有文章第一个图片和 iframe 不是懒加载,如果第一个文章没图和 iframe,...自定义 因为大多数大多数主题是使用单列布局来显示文章,所以不懒加载第一个内容中图片或 iframe 可以增强了页面的 LCP 性能,而对于多列布局主题,WordPress 现在提供了新 wp_omit_loading_attr_threshold...例如,在列表使用三列布局主题就可以利用过滤器将列表页面上该阈值修改为 3,这会让前三个内容图片/iframe 不会被懒加载: add_filter('wp_omit_loading_attr_threshold

71620

迁移 valine 评论数据至 wordpress 数据库

数据迁移 一直以来leancloud都提供了数据导出服务,格式为 json line(jsonl),这里其实很方便了,因为市面上大多数评论系统都可以json格式数据进行导入迁移数据,也就是说我们只需要把导出...此处可无视 key 值选项,后面需要自定义 comment_ID 为主键 完成 json 到 sql 到转换后,将转换后 sql 文件下载到本地,根据 wp 数据库中自带 wp_comments 数据表结构进行进一步编辑...数据关联(主要) 在关联数据时,我们需要解决以下2个问题: valine/wordpress 是如何关联评论数据到对应页面的? valine/wordpress 是如何关联子评论数据到父评论?...则直接在评论数据表中通过 comment_parent(默认 0)字段来关联其对应其评论 comment_ID 字段。...($utc_date)) 转换为普通日期格式 Y-m-d H:i:s 后再导入到 sql 文件,参考上方UTC时间格式化)(⚠️注意:若导入时候数据映射步骤显示不全,则表示 json 对象中首行中未包含缺失数据

9600

WordPress主题开发基础:Body 类指南

>> WordPress根据显示页面类型自动添加适当类。 例如,如果您在存档页面上,WordPress将自动将存档类添加到body元素。它几乎针对每个页面都执行此操作。...您可以自定义特定作者个人资料页面,基于日期档案等。 现在让我们看一下如何以及何时使用body类。...在向您展示特定用例场景之前,我们将向您展示如何使用过滤器添加body类,以便每个人都可以在同一面上。...现在,您可以直接在主题样式表中使用此CSS类。如果您在自己网站上工作,则还可以使用主题定制器中自定义CSS功能添加CSS 。 您可以选择要启用body分类功能文章类型以及谁可以访问它。...将分类名称添加到单个文章页面的body类中 假设您要根据单个文章分类来自定义它们外观。您可以使用body类来实现此目的 首先,您需要在单个文章页面上将分类名称添加为CSS类。

2K20

WordPress插件大全

Replace WP-Version – 可以将 WP 版本信息改为随机字符串。防止别人根据不同版本漏洞来攻击你博客。...Different Posts Per Page – 允许你设置不同页面显示文章数,比如首页显示7篇、分类显示9篇。 Domain Mirror – 在不同域名上建立多个镜像。...Homepage Excerpts – 允许在首页第一显示全文输出,而在第二之后显示文章摘要输出。 In Series Plugin – 制作一系列相关文章。...wp-cats – 批量管理文章分类和标签。 WP-Cron – 计划任务插件,比如配合备份插件使用,可以自动定时备份然后发送到你邮箱。 WP-Custom Login – 自定义登录界面。...Currency Converter – 获取来自Yahoo Finance实时财经资讯。 Email Users – 可以根据注册用户不同权限给他们发送电子邮件。

1.9K50

WordPress是怎么设计扩展字段

这些自定义字段存储为元数据,可以在编辑页面中填写,也可以在发布内容中显示。...在前端显示这些自定义字段也很方便,WordPress提供了get_post_meta() 函数来获取并显示字段值。可以直接在模板文件中调用该函数显示。...它是存储在wp_postmeta表中,所有的自定义字段都混在一起,不够结构化。而且字段类型单一,扩展性有限。...在WordPress中,自定义字段表设计通常采用wp_postmeta表,该表存储了每篇文章或页面的元数据,包括自定义字段名称和值。...meta_key:自定义字段名称,以字符串类型存储。 meta_value:自定义字段值,以字符串类型存储。 在wp_postmeta表中,每个自定义字段都对应一条记录。

19220

WordPress 自定义字段 自定义使用方法

WordPress自定义字段是个非常有用功能,自定义域是对wp文章功能扩展和补充,通过使用WP自定义字段功能,可以给文章增加些额外内容,如用WP做淘客模板时给产品添加商品价格显示,添加购买链接等...下面博客吧详细介绍wp自定义字段使用方法步骤。...WordPress自定义字段使用方法: 在使用WordPress撰写文章时候,在内容输入框下面有一个“自定义栏目”(没有发现童鞋,在后台顶部,点击“显示选项”——勾选“自定义栏目”) 点击“输入新栏目...”,在名称里输入自定义字段名称,如link,然后在值里输入自定义字段值,如https://qintia.com 然后点击“添加自定义栏目”,最后直接发表文章即可。...提示:每个自定义字段添加一次即可,下次使用可直接在下拉菜单中选择。 自定义字段调用: <?php echo get_post_meta($post_id, $key, $single); ?

1.8K20

WordPress主题基本模板及常用函数

('Y-m-d'):显示时间格式化 get_post_meta():获取保存在post_meta这个表数据,比如输出某个自定义字段内容 the_ID():特定内容ID the_tags('关键字'...,'',''):显示文章关键tag the_excerpt():post/page摘要,输入文章发布页面中摘要面板内容 the_content('more'):显示内容(post/page)全文...wp_list_pages():显示page列表,常用于显示单篇文章分页,配合 来使用 edit_post_link() : 如果用户已登录并具有权限,显示编辑链接 posts_nav_link(); : 显示上一/下一链接,通常用在索引、分类和文章存档...:根据作者邮箱输出作者头像 php wp_list_categories() : 显示Categories列表 php get_calendar() : 日历 php wp_get_archives

83910

wordpress 学习笔记 (二)

详细说明 screenshot.png 缩略图 显示在后台主题列表封面 taxonomy.php 自定义分类法 通用自定义分类法显示模板 taxonomy-XXX.php 指定分类法 author.php...阅读设置:为默认设置时候 查询出最新文章 自定义: [is_home] => 1 ,[is_page] => 1 阅读设置:为自定义页面的时候 查询出来是设置页面 11.搜索查询 [is_serch...] => 当前是搜索 没有[query_object]字段 12....错误【404】页面的查询 [is_404] => 当前是404 没有[query_object]字段 [posts] [post] 里面都为空 13....获取文章所属标签信息(tags) wp模板标签the_tags用于在文章输出标签链接 函数参数 ① $before 字符串值,默认值:null 在标签链接 前 显示文本。

91020
领券